PittS 12 Python 50E
The new PittS 12 Python 50E ARF was designed by Italy
aerobatic pilot, Sebastiano Silvestri.
This professional ARF kit is the result of Sebastiano's long
research in 3D performance and precision. This combined with an
extremely lightweight structure, the all wood airframe and the big
control surfaces give the PittS 12 Python 50E an impressive
thrust-to-weight ratio and crisp control authority at any airspeed
and flight condition.
The PittS 12 Python 50E can do it all... precision aerobatics
manouvres... easy harriers, torque rolls, blenders, waterfalls and
all this for a biplane of this class is unbelievable!
Specifications:
Wing Span:...........................................135 cm
Length:............................................ 145 cm
Wing Area:............................................ 61 dm2
Weight:........................2.300 g. RTF less battery
Radio: 6-Channel with 4 mini + 2 standard servo

Recommended power set up:
Motor:....................... Hacker A50-16S
ESC:............Master basic 70 S-BEC
Battery: ..........Flight Power 4270-6S
Propeller: .................... APC 17x8E

  • Page 33: Mixing

    Modellbau Lindinger GmbH Mixing For best performance, we recommend a linear-mix*: Rudder Elevator UP When you give full rudder to the right or left side, the elevator have to go up (positive) approx. 8% Rudder Ailerons When you give full rudder to the right, all four ailerons need to go left, approx. 2% when you give full rudder to the left, all four ailerons need to go right, approx.
